What is SQL?

SQL is a standard language for accessing databases. It is used to perform operations on the records stored in the database such as updating records, deleting records, creating and modifying tables, views, etc. SQL is a server-side scripting language. It is designed for managing data in a relational database management system (RDBMS). SQL is based on relational algebra and tuple relational calculus. SQL is just a query language, it is not a database. To perform SQL queries, you need to install any database for example Oracle, MySQL, MongoDB, PostgreSQL, SQL Server, DB2, etc.

Before starting SQL, relational databases have several points that are important to keep in mind :

RDBMS:- RDBMS stands for Relational Database Management System.
Data Integrity:- Avoid data duplication
SQL Constraints:- SQL Constraints are the rules which are applied to table columns.
Better security:- Assign grant or privilege to an individual User.
Database Normalization:- It is the process to store database data very efficiently

Why SQL :

  • To insert records in a database.
  • To update records in a database.
  • To delete records from a database.
  • To retrieve data from a database.
  • Create new databases, tables, and views.
SQL Structure